If you can get the update from the Apple store it may help The latest Fitbit App version I see requires iOS13.4 or later. To find your App version
Tap your user icon at the top left of the Today screen.
On the Account page scroll down and tap "Help & Support"
Your iOS release is at the top (mine was 3.47 (ignore this number normally) with the error on iOS15.1) it is now 3.48 after today's update and the error is corrected. @NorfolkReg @3amp @CindyMFitbit @SunsetRunner @SunsetRunner @SunsetRunner

Currently I'm running iOS 15.0.1 and Fitbit app version 3.48 and this is the version that fixed the issue with the private messages in my case. So you can double check if that version is now available for you. Sometimes Fitbit takes time to release the new version for all the users.
